jFeed 开源项目教程

jFeed 开源项目教程

jFeedjQuery RSS/ATOM feed parser plugin项目地址:https://gitcode.com/gh_mirrors/jf/jFeed

项目介绍

jFeed 是一个基于 jQuery 的 RSS/ATOM 订阅源解析插件。它允许开发者轻松地从 RSS 或 ATOM 订阅源中提取数据,并在网页上展示。jFeed 支持多种订阅源格式,并提供了简单易用的 API 接口,使得集成到现有项目中变得非常方便。

项目快速启动

安装

首先,确保你的项目中已经包含了 jQuery。然后,你可以通过以下方式引入 jFeed:

<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="path/to/jfeed.js"></script>

使用示例

以下是一个简单的示例,展示如何使用 jFeed 获取并解析一个 RSS 订阅源: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>jFeed 示例</title>
    <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
    <script src="path/to/jfeed.js"></script>
</head>
<body>
    <div id="feed"></div>
    <script>
        $(document).ready(function() {
            $.getFeed({
                url: 'https://example.com/rss.xml',
                success: function(feed) {
                    var html = '<h1>' + feed.title + '</h1>';
                    html += '<ul>';
                    $.each(feed.items, function(i, item) {
                        html += '<li><a href="' + item.link + '">' + item.title + '</a></li>';
                    });
                    html += '</ul>';
                    $('#feed').html(html);
                }
            });
        });
    </script>
</body>
</html>

应用案例和最佳实践

应用案例

  1. 新闻网站:使用 jFeed 从多个新闻源获取最新的新闻内容,并在网站上展示。
  2. 博客聚合:将多个博客的 RSS 订阅源聚合到一个页面,方便用户浏览。
  3. 社交媒体监控:通过解析社交媒体的 RSS 订阅源,实时监控特定话题或关键词的动态。

最佳实践

  1. 错误处理:在获取订阅源时,添加错误处理逻辑,确保在订阅源无法获取时,用户能够看到友好的提示信息。
  2. 性能优化:对于频繁更新的订阅源,考虑使用缓存机制,减少对服务器的不必要请求。
  3. 用户体验:在展示订阅源内容时,确保页面布局清晰,便于用户阅读。

典型生态项目

jFeed 作为一个 RSS/ATOM 订阅源解析插件,可以与以下类型的项目结合使用:

  1. 内容管理系统(CMS):如 WordPress、Joomla 等,通过集成 jFeed,可以方便地展示外部内容。
  2. 前端框架:如 React、Vue.js 等,通过封装 jFeed 的功能,可以在这些框架中轻松使用。
  3. 数据可视化工具:如 D3.js、Highcharts 等,通过解析订阅源数据,可以实现动态的数据可视化效果。

通过以上模块的介绍,你可以快速上手并应用 jFeed 开源项目,实现 RSS/ATOM 订阅源的解析和展示。

jFeedjQuery RSS/ATOM feed parser plugin项目地址:https://gitcode.com/gh_mirrors/jf/jFeed

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

滑姗珊

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值